About Master of Human Resource Management [MHRM]
Master of Human Resource Management (MHRM) is a 2-year postgraduate programme offered by MES College Marampally, an autonomous institution affiliated with Mahatma Gandhi University, Kottayam. The course provides specialized training in human resource management, organizational development, talent management, and strategic HR planning. The total fees for the course is 37,500 (18,750 per semester for 4 semesters). The course is offered in full-time on-campus mode. MHRM is popular among students interested in HR careers, offering diverse opportunities in talent acquisition, organizational development, employee relations, and strategic human resource management.
Admissions for 2026-27 are currently ongoing. Candidates can apply directly through the college's online admission portal at mesmarampally.embase.in. The application process involves submitting applications online with the prescribed application fee. After the closing date, the college prepares a rank list based on merit. Candidates in the Sure List can download their allotment memo and confirm admission by paying the allotment fee. Final admission is completed by reporting to the college with required documents on the specified date.

Eligibility Criteria:
- Bachelor's degree in any discipline from a recognized university
- Minimum CGPA of 2.00 out of 4.00 or CCPA of 5.00 out of 10 in the core group
- Valid score in qualifying examination as per university norms
- Work experience is preferred but not mandatory
Admission Process:
- Submit online application through the college's admission portal with prescribed application fee
- Await publication of merit-based rank list on the college website
- Download allotment memo from individual login if included in Sure List
- Pay allotment fee within stipulated time to confirm admission
- Report to college on specified date with required documents for final admission
- Complete enrollment after full fee payment

Ques. Is MHRM different from MBA HRM?
Ans. Yes, MHRM is a specialized master's degree focused exclusively on human resource management, while MBA HRM is a general MBA with HR specialization. MHRM provides deeper and more specialized knowledge in HR management, making it ideal for those specifically interested in HR careers.
